Italy - Chestnut Producer Price Index
Since 2011, Italy Chestnut Producer Price Index was up 8.7% year on year. At 168.95 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100 in 2016, the country was number 13 comparing other countries in Chestnut Producer Price Index. Italy is overtaken by South Korea, which was number 12 at 174.46 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100 and is followed by France with 167.7 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100. Bolivia lead the ranking with 812.47 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100 in 2017, a growth of 75% compared to 2016. Ukraine, Albania and Turkey resp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Bolivia witnessed the best average annual growth at +33.5% per year, while Spain recorded the worst performance at -4.6% per year.
